SUPERNOVA 2007oo IN UGC 12558


Further to CBET 1096, R. Mostardi and W. Li report the discovery of an
apparent supernova on unfiltered KAIT images taken on Nov. 6.21 (at mag 18.9)
and 7.21 UT (mag 18.8).  The new object is located at R.A. = 23h22m19s.50,
Decl. = +50o09'20".0 (equinox 2000.0), which is 2".7 east and 12".4 south of
the nucleus of UGC 12558.  KAIT images taken on 2006 Nov. 11.19 (limiting mag
20.0) and 2007 Oct. 31.23 (limiting mag 19.5) showed nothing at this location.
